Taco Cauliflower Rice Bowls

Description

Delicious and healthy taco cauliflower rice bowls loaded with fresh ingredients.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b ground chicken or beef, turkey, or plant-based protein
  • 1 packet taco seasoning
  • 3 cups cauliflower rice
  • 4 cups romaine lettuce, chopped
  • 1 large avocado, diced
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 0 cup red onion, finely diced
  • 1 cup Mexican cheese blend, shredded
  • 0 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
  • 0 cup sugar-free salsa
  • 0 cup full-fat sour cream
  • 2 tbsp fresh lime juice
  • 1 whole jalapeño, minced

Instructions

  1. In a skillet, cook ground chicken or beef until browned. Add taco seasoning and mix well.
  2. In a separate pan, sauté cauliflower rice until tender.
  3. In serving bowls, layer romaine lettuce, cauliflower rice, and the meat mixture.
  4. Top with diced avocado, cherry tomatoes, red onion, cheese, cilantro, salsa, sour cream, lime juice, and jalapeño.

Notes

  • For a vegetarian option, use plant-based protein.
  • Feel free to adjust toppings based on your preference.
